FRANCIA REYES, María Elena and MAURIZ MARTINEZ, Nancy. ¿Por qué no aprendemos?. Rev Cubana Med Gen Integr [online]. 2003, vol.19, n.2. ISSN 0864-2125.
A retrospective descriptive and cross-sectional study was carried out with 20 children from first to fourth grades, who studied at "Jose Joaquín Palma" elementary school located in the people's council Pueblo Nuevo in Centro Habana municipality. The sample showed learning difficulties during 1991-2000 school year. Our objective was to determine the percentage of the sample in which slow learning is associated with normal intellectual quotient so that we can provide better counseling to the families of children with these learning difficulties. A small questionnaire validated by judges was administered. The results revealed that 75% of children had normal intellectual quotients.
